개발은 처음이라 개발새발

[Tableau] FIRST / LAST 라벨링 본문

태블로

[Tableau] FIRST / LAST 라벨링

leon_choi 2024. 2. 14. 16:14
반응형

FIRST/LAST 라벨링

 

IF문을 활용하면 처음부분과 마지막 부분의 라벨을 다르게 표시할 수 있는데요. 우선 계산 필드를 같이 보겠습니다.

/*FIRST&LAST */

IF FIRST()=0 THEN 'FIRST'
ELSEIF LAST()=0 THEN 'LAST'
ELSE 'NORMAL'
END

 

막대차트 라벨링과 크게 다르지 않은 구문인데 여기서 특이한 것은 FIRST() = 0 / LAST () = 0 일 겁니다. "FIRST() = 0"이란 첫 지점에서 얼마나 떨어져 있는지 나타낸다고 보면 됩니다. 그렇다면 FIRT() = 0은 시작점이라는 것을 뜻합니다. 이렇게 계산 필드를 만들어 색상에 적용하면 위와 같이 시작점과 끝점을 다르게 라벨링하는 표를 생성할 수 있습니다.

반응형